Analysis
The most recent figure for maize (corn) — burning crop residues (emissions n2o), annual growth in Africa is 2.1 % change on previous year, measured in 2023.
That represents a change of up 701.2% on the previous year and down 40.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, maize (corn) — burning crop residues (emissions n2o), annual growth in Africa peaked at 10.86 % change on previous year in 1986 and was at its lowest, -7.06 % change on previous year, in 1995.
Africa ranks 15th of 35 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
